Evolutionary Psychology
A theoretical approach that examines mental traits such as memory, perception, and language from the perspective of human evolution and natural selection.

Evolutionary Psychology
A theoretical approach in psychology that explains human thoughts and behaviors as adaptations, evolved to solve problems of survival and reproduction.
